Why is the Mona Lisa so famous?

More than 500 years after its creation, Leonardo da Vinci’s Mona Lisa is arguably the world’s most famous painting. Many scholars consider it an outstanding work of Renaissance art – but history is full of great paintings. So, how did this particular portrait skyrocket to unprecedented fame? Ted-Ed investigates.
